'Rogers' came from the film star Will Rogers.
'Roy,came from a 'list' of possible names.
Roy Rogers first appeared in films with the screen name 'Dick Weston'
'Trigger' was Roy's horse. You can see his story in the movie "My Pal Trigger".Trigger :)
The singing cowboy Roy Rogers' real last name was Slye .Leonard Franklin Slye was his full name .

Roy Rogers last appeared in the 1975 film "Mackintosh and T.J." . This was the last feature-length film in which Roy Rogers (November 5, 1911 - July 6, 1998) appeared .

Roy Rogers had a German Shepherd . The dog's name was "Bullet" .

The cowboy Roy Rogers was the character name of Leonard Franklin Slye, so it could be questional if that was a Roy Rogers but there is a slide and blues guitarist born 1950 in Redding, California who also called himself Roy Rogers.
